    Description

    This is a rare opportunity for the buyers to build their dream home on this south facing level land. It has a wide frontage in a prime location in the affluent city of Arcadia. According to City of Arcadia's development standards, maximum allowable building size is 5,522 square feet, including ADUs. It's in Arcadia Unified School District with Arcadia High School, Dana Junior High School and Camino Grove Elementary School. There are existing block walls in the northern and eastern perimeters of the property. Connection to gas, electricity, water and other utilities are in the vicinity. Buyers and builders are encouraged to check with your architect and city on allowable building size and other related uses.
